LULULEMON SOHO
This project included a full renovation of the former Aritzia space at 524 Broadway in Soho, transforming 17,500 ft² across two floors into a redesigned retail store. The ground floor was reconfigured to include stock rooms, fitting rooms, sales areas, a mechanical room, and a point-of-sale area, while the second floor was updated with additional back-of-house and stock spaces, fitting rooms, sales areas, a flex/mothball area, and another point-of-sale zone.
The project was carried out in two phases—a feasibility study followed by design services—with MEYERS+ providing MEP/FP/FA design and consulting for both stages.
